The Perspective Tool is used to change the perspective of the active layer content, of the selection boundaries or of a path. When you click on the image, according to the Preview type you have selected, a rectangular frame or a grid pops up around the selection (or around the whole layer if there is no selection), with a handle on each of the four corners. By moving these handles by click-and-drag, you can modify the perspective. At the same time, a “Transformation informations” pop up, which lets you valid the transformation. At the center of the element, a point lets you move the element by click-and-drag.
